Wigan Wallgate Station stands out not just for its conveniency but also for its comprehensive facilities that make every journey a bit smoother. The ticket office accommodates travelers every day of the week, opening early at 6:00 AM from Monday to Saturday. For those preferring a self-service option, ticket machines are accessible and come with the capability to collect online purchases. Unlike many stations, Wigan Wallgate places a premium on accessibility, boasting step-free access across the board, along with induction loops and accessible ticket machines.
The station doesn’t offer lounges, but there’s ample seating space for waiting passengers. Furthermore, security is a priority there, with extensive CCTV coverage and specified cycling storage areas including lockers and stands—a boon for any cyclist. Unfortunately, an absence of catering services, ATMs, and baby-changing facilities might see you better served heading out into the nearby town center for some essentials.
Once at Wigan Wallgate, you are not limited to just rail travel. Convenient transport connections abound, allowing for onward travel throughout the area. The rail replacement service is efficiently picked up from the Wallgate service bus stop. There is also a strategically located bus line adjacent to Wigan North Western rail station, providing connections to St Helens, Southport, Ormskirk, and Warrington. For those moments when taxis are the best option, nearby services can easily be booked through the Northern Railway Cab4You service.

Elsenham Station boasts a range of ticketing facilities to facilitate a seamless travel experience. The ticket office is open from 06:00 to 13:30 from Monday to Saturday, ensuring you can get tickets or resolve queries in person. Although not operational on Sundays, you’ll find ticket machines on-site for round-the-clock service, allowing you to collect pre-purchased tickets at your convenience.
The station has suitably accessible infrastructure. With step-free access available between platforms via Old Mead Road, travellers with mobility needs are well-catered for. There's also an induction loop available for those with hearing impairments, making the station user-friendly for all.
While Elsenham may lack some facilities like luggage storage and toilets, it compensates with its service offerings in other areas. Refreshments can be found by the entrance to Platform 2, ensuring you stay nourished on your travels. Public Wi-Fi is available to keep you connected, and sheltered bicycle storage caters to cyclists, providing stands on each platform.
Safety is assured as the station is equipped with CCTV, and help points are strategically located to assist travellers as needed. While there aren't any launch facilities or 1st Class lounges, waiting rooms with seating areas are available, offering a comfortable spot to rest between journeys.
Getting to and from Elsenham Station is made easy with various transport links. While there are no accessible taxis or dedicated set-down points, local bus services integrate seamlessly with the train schedules. For those unexpected schedule changes, rail replacement services can be accessed at the nearby Station Road and New Road bus stop.
